  • Target

    GMFB (Glia Maturation Factor, beta (GMFB))

    Alternative Name

    GMF-beta

    Background

    GMFB, Glia maturation factor beta, GMF-betaThis protein causes differentiation of brain cells, stimulation of neural regeneration, and inhibition of proliferation of tumor cells.

    Molecular Weight

    17kD

    Gene ID

    2764

    UniProt

    P60983
